Output 63f2e7839406e735ac68e91a0d06f0b81df8fe153d1fe2a5d70a0e32bd0914cf:25

value
3943135
script pubkey
OP_0 OP_PUSHBYTES_20 0af1448cc76a1cf024689ea205c297e0d4c92c5d
address
bc1qptc5frx8dgw0qfrgn63qts5hur2vjtza3hz3t4
transaction
63f2e7839406e735ac68e91a0d06f0b81df8fe153d1fe2a5d70a0e32bd0914cf